Montague is a town located in the county of Franklin in the U.S. state of Massachusetts. Its population at the 2010 census was 8,437 and a population density of 104 people per km². After 10 years in 2020 city had an estimated population of 8,203 inhabitants.
The town was created 310 years ago in 1714.
